Cookies

Our websites use so-called “cookies”. Cookies are small data packages and do not cause any damage to your device. They are either stored temporarily on your device for the duration of a session (session cookies) or permanently (persistent cookies). Session cookies are automatically deleted at the end of your visit. Persistent cookies remain stored on your device until you delete them yourself or your web browser automatically deletes them.

Cookies may originate from us (first-party cookies) or from third-party companies (so-called third-party cookies). Third-party cookies enable the integration of certain services from third-party companies within websites (e.g. cookies for processing payment services).

Cookies have various functions. Many cookies are technically necessary because certain website functions would not work without them (e.g. shopping cart functions or video displays). Other cookies may be used to analyse user behaviour or for advertising purposes.

Cookies that are required for carrying out the electronic communication process, providing certain functions requested by you (e.g. shopping cart functions), or optimising the website (e.g. cookies for measuring website traffic) (necessary cookies) are stored on the basis of Art. 6 para. 1 lit. f GDPR, unless another legal basis is specified. The website operator has a legitimate interest in storing necessary cookies for the technically error-free and optimised provision of its services. If consent to the storage of cookies and similar recognition technologies has been requested, processing is carried out exclusively on the basis of this consent (Art. 6 para. 1 lit. a GDPR and Section 25 para. 1 TDDDG); consent can be revoked at any time.

You can configure your browser so that you are informed about the setting of cookies and only allow cookies in individual cases, exclude the acceptance of cookies for certain cases or generally, and activate the automatic deletion of cookies when closing the browser. If cookies are deactivated, the functionality of this website may be restricted.

Google reCAPTCHA

We use “Google reCAPTCHA” (hereinafter “reCAPTCHA”) on this website. The provider is Google Ireland Limited (“Google”), Gordon House, Barrow Street, Dublin 4, Ireland.

reCAPTCHA is used to check whether data entered on this website (e.g. in a contact form) is provided by a human or by an automated programme. For this purpose, reCAPTCHA analyses the behaviour of website visitors based on various characteristics. This analysis begins automatically as soon as the website visitor enters the website. For the analysis, reCAPTCHA evaluates various information (e.g. IP address, time spent by the website visitor on the website, or mouse movements made by the user). The data collected during the analysis is forwarded to Google.

The reCAPTCHA analyses run completely in the background. Website visitors are not informed that an analysis is taking place.

In this context, Google acts solely as a data processor within the meaning of Art. 28 GDPR and will not use the data collected in this way for its own purposes. The use of this tool is based on a data processing agreement (DPA) with Google.
